Brighton Jones LLC grew its position in shares of Bank of America Corporation (NYSE:BAC – Free Report) by 12.8% during the 3rd qu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The fund owned 129,189 shares of the financial services provider’s stock after buying an additional 14,697 shares during the quarter. Brighton Jones LLC’s holdings in Bank of America were worth $6,665,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

Bank of America Trading Up 1.7%
NYSE BAC opened at $55.19 on Monday. Bank of America Corporation has a one year low of $33.06 and a one year high of $56.07.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.12, a current ratio of 0.79 and a quick ratio of 0.79. The firm has a market cap of $403.02 billion, a P/E ratio of 15.04 and a beta of 1.30. The stock’s 50-day moving average is $52.89 and its 200-day moving average is $49.90.
Bank of America Dividend Announcement
The business also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Friday, December 26th. Investors of record on Friday, December 5th will be issued a dividend of $0.28 per share. This represents a $1.12 annualized dividend and a yield of 2.0%. The ex-dividend date is Friday, December 5th. Bank of America’s dividend payout ratio is presently 30.52%.

Bank of America Profile
Bank of America Corporation is a multinational financial services company headquartered in Charlotte, North Carolina. It provides a broad array of banking, investment, asset management and related financial and risk management products and services to individual consumers, small- and middle-market businesses, large corporations, governments and institutional investors. The firm operates through consumer banking, global wealth and investment management, global banking and markets businesses, offering capabilities across lending, deposits, payments, advisory and capital markets.
Its consumer-facing offerings include checking and savings accounts, mortgages, home equity lending, auto loans, credit cards and small business banking, supported by a nationwide branch network and digital channels.
